A candidate that stands out in the Tipperary North constituency is Diana O’Dwyer who has a range of skills and talents which she can bring to the fore should she get elected.

A Dáil researcher for People Before Profit, she feels the time is right now for a profound change of how people vote in Tipperary.

Diana O’Dwyer has always looked to make a difference and build an Ireland that helps those in need, which is something close to her heart.

She has been a socialist activist for nearly 20 years and in that time has campaigned against many Government decisions that many feel were unjust such as water charges and housing action.

Also “to repeal” and more recently, to stop the genocide in Gaza have been priorities for her.
